我的2.6.1 RELEASE 20081208,用户中心里的资金管理报错。

2016-07-07 15:47 来源:www.chinab4c.com 作者:ecshop专家



我的2.6.1 RELEASE 20081208,登陆进去后点用户中心里的资金管理就报以下错。

MySQL server error report:Array ( [0] => Array ( [message] => MySQL Query Error ) [1] => Array ( [sql] => SELECT SUM(user_money) FROM `sankelloff`.`ecs_account_log` WHERE user_id = '2' ) [2] => Array ( [error] => Table 'sankelloff.ecs_account_log' doesn't exist ) [3] => Array ( [errno] => 1146 ) )

回答:
找到方法了。但是说得不详细。新手还是不明白。

缺数据表,在后台SQL查询里执行一下
  1. DROP TABLE IF EXISTS `ecs_account_log`;
  2. CREATE TABLE `ecs_account_log` (
  3. `log_id` mediumint(8) unsigned NOT NULL auto_increment,
  4. `user_id` mediumint(8) unsigned NOT NULL,
  5. `user_money` decimal(10,2) NOT NULL,
  6. `frozen_money` decimal(10,2) NOT NULL,
  7. `rank_points` mediumint(9) NOT NULL,
  8. `pay_points` mediumint(9) NOT NULL,
  9. `change_time` int(10) unsigned NOT NULL,
  10. `change_desc` varchar(255) NOT NULL,
  11. `change_type` tinyint(3) unsigned NOT NULL,
  12. PRIMARY KEY(`log_id`),
  13. KEY `user_id` (`user_id`)
  14. ) TYPE=MyISAM;
复制代码